Cavernous Wall


An HDR panoramic image spanning two levels inside Luray Caverns, Virginia. Created from four sets of five exposure series, with a 2 ev. spacing, the HDR images were toned and stitched as a 32 bit depth image inside Photoshop 5 and saved as a "radiance" file. Photomatix 4 was used to tonemap the final result. Further touches in Lightroom 3.
